Napoli are on the brink of securing the Serie A title as they prepare for their final match against Cagliari. They hold a one-point lead over Inter, and a win at the Stadio Diego Armando Maradona would clinch their first top-flight title since the 2022-23 season. This achievement would mark a historic moment, as Napoli could become the first team to win the Scudetto after finishing 10th in the previous season.
Inter, meanwhile, are still in contention and will face Como at the Stadio Giuseppe Sinigaglia. Como have been impressive at home, winning their last three league matches. They aim to become the first newly promoted team to secure four consecutive home victories since Hellas Verona in 2020. However, they face a formidable challenge against Simone Inzaghi's side, who have won their last eight Serie A matches against Como, conceding only twice.

The battle for the final Champions League spot is equally intense. Juventus currently occupy fourth place and are set to play against 19th-placed Venezia away from home. Despite not winning any of their four away league matches under Igor Tudor (D3 L1), Juventus have a strong record against Venezia, winning 16 of their last 20 encounters in Serie A.
Roma, sitting fifth and just one point behind Juventus, will take on Torino in Claudio Ranieri's final game before his second retirement. Ranieri recently celebrated his 500th Serie A game with a victory over AC Milan. If Juventus falter and Roma triumph over Torino, Roma could qualify for the Champions League for the first time since 2017-18.
At the bottom of the table, several teams are fighting to avoid relegation alongside already-relegated Monza. Venezia are in 19th place, while Empoli and Lecce share the final relegation spot with 31 points each. Parma and Hellas Verona are also under pressure with 33 and 34 points respectively.
Empoli will host Verona in Sunday's decisive match, while Parma face a challenging trip to Atalanta, who have little left to play for this season. The outcome of these matches will determine which teams remain in Serie A next season.
Milan will conclude their campaign against Monza in what might be Sergio Conceicao's last match as manager following an underwhelming season. Despite winning the Supercoppa Italiana in January, Milan struggled in Serie A and lost the Coppa Italia final to Bologna earlier this month.
The Opta supercomputer predicts Napoli as favourites to win the title, giving them an 86.2% chance based on data simulations. Inter's chances stand at 13.8%. Beyond the title race, three teams will compete on Sunday for a coveted Champions League spot.
Lazio end their season against Lecce and depend on favourable results from Venezia and Torino to secure a Champions League berth at the last moment.
